Ambler Campus: Dessert & Dialogue with Tikvah

    Temple University Ambler Campus
    Dessert  Dialogue with Tikvah

    Tikvah AJMI will be hosting a special “Dessert and Dialogue on Sunday, November 19, at 2 p.m., at Temple Ambler. Edie Mannion, MFT, LMFT, will present “Family Recovery Tips & Resources for Healing Family Relationships Affected by Mental Health Disorders.”

    The program is free and open to the public. Advanced registration is required. Register at office@tikvahjmi.org.

    Tikvah is a grassroots Jewish organization established by parents and mental health professionals committed to improving the quality of life for adults of all ages with mental illness. Tikvah is a social program aimed at promoting community opportunities. Tikvah focuses on events where members feel safe and have fun in the company of others. Tikvah welcomes and serves people of all faiths.
